DTF Powders Must Match Your Chosen DTF Films

One of the most common mistakes made by beginners is assuming all dtf powders will perform the same with any film. In reality dtf powders need to bond well with the ink as well as the film surface. If the powder does not adhere properly to the wet ink on the film or if it does not melt uniformly during the curing process it can result in peeling or cracking. High quality dtf powders are designed to work with specific film types such as hot peel or cold peel and choosing the right match improves the durability and flexibility of the final transfer.

DTF Films Vary by Coating Finish and Peeling Method

When selecting dtf films beginners should consider several key factors including peel type coating thickness and anti static features. There are two main types of dtf films hot peel and cold peel. Hot peel films allow the transfer to be peeled shortly after pressing which speeds up production while cold peel requires cooling before removal to ensure the design stays intact. Coating quality also matters since uneven coating can lead to smudges or incomplete transfers. High grade dtf films ensure smooth ink absorption and crisp design definition across all printing surfaces.

DTF Inks Must Be Compatible with the Film Surface

Using the right dtf inks is essential to prevent streaking pooling or fading after application. Some dtf inks are thicker or more pigmented which may behave differently on various dtf films. To ensure a seamless workflow make sure your ink is designed to work with your film type and that your printer settings accommodate for the film's coating thickness. Reliable dtf inks will cure evenly provide vibrant color saturation and offer strong adhesion to both the film and the fabric after transfer.

DTF Supplies Must Be Stored Correctly for Best Results

Even the best dtf supplies can fail if not stored and handled properly. DTF films should be kept flat in a cool dry place to prevent warping or dust contamination. DTF powders need to be sealed airtight and dtf inks should be shaken before use and stored upright to prevent settling. A clean environment free of static electricity and humidity helps prolong the life of your dtf supplies and ensures you’re always working with materials that perform at their highest potential during each stage of printing.

Beginner Tips for Testing and Using DTF Films Successfully

If you’re just starting with dtf films begin by running small test prints using different film types and thicknesses. Observe how each responds to your ink curing time and powder application. Keep a log of which dtf films produce the best results with your setup and always print at the recommended temperature and pressure levels. Don't forget to review the drying behavior of your dtf inks and how well your dtf powders melt onto the film. Consistent testing and observation will help you quickly identify the ideal materials for your process and avoid unnecessary trial and error.

Frequently Asked Questions

  • What is the difference between hot peel and cold peel DTF films
    Hot peel can be removed immediately after pressing while cold peel needs cooling time
  • Can I use the same film for all fabric types
    Some films perform better on specific fabrics always test before full production
  • Do DTF films expire
    They can degrade over time if exposed to moisture or stored improperly
  • How do I store unused DTF films
    Keep them flat in a cool dry environment away from sunlight and humidity
  • Why is my film curling during printing
    This is often caused by poor storage conditions or low quality film material
  • Can I reuse DTF film sheets
    No once printed and cured they cannot be reused for new designs
  • What causes powder not to stick to the film
    Either the ink dried too fast or the film's coating is not compatible
  • Are thicker films better than thinner ones
    Not necessarily it depends on your printer and pressing method compatibility
  • Should I preheat my film before printing
    It is not usually necessary but room temperature films work more consistently
  • Can I print white designs with DTF films
    Yes just ensure your printer has white ink and that your film supports white layers
